Ocean carriers began passing through Panama Canal cost pressures this week, with MSC applying a $297 per 40ft Panama Canal surcharge from September 12 and CMA CGM levying a $500 per TEU 'Panama Canal Adjustment Factor.' The canal authority is cutting daily transits to 32 from September 15, down from 34 earlier in the month, and capping Neo-Panamax draft at 48.0 feet. US East Coast bound cargo faces further upward rate pressure into the Golden Week period as transit slots shrink.
